After months of speculation as to the future of the World Poker Tour it has finally been announced that the once popular brand has been sold to an investment group called Gamynia Limited for $9,075,000 plus a percentage of future revenues. So far chairman of the House Committee on Financial Services, Barny Frank, has been able to marshal 50 members of the US Congress to co-sponsor the Internet Gambling Regulation, Consumer Protection and Enforcement Act (H.R. 2267). Dublin was voted the European Poker Capital by Bluff Europe Magazine. Dublin narrowly edged out London for the title. Dublin also won the title from Bluff Europe in 2008. According to Poker King, WSOP Main Event final table chip leader Darvin Moon has turned down offers from both Full Tilt Poker and Poker Stars to wear their gear when the final gets underway in November. Following speculation over what Russia’s new crackdown on gambling might mean for the already scheduled European Poker Tour Moscow event, Poker Stars has announced that they have canceled the Moscow even and will instead hold a tournament in Kiev.
